I ran across this version of basic recently and am quite impressed. It works well with all versions of windows, very inexpensive (you can down load free trial versions) and very powerful. It is not Visual Basic; however it will do a lot including multiple windows, buttons, graphics etc. Any one interested in an easy to use and resonably good basic language might want to check it out. It is distruuted by Shoptalk Systems in Framingham, MA.
